Output c4fd590d72412353bc023e5caabcb924be7aeb66c59849daaa01672605681879:17

value
253684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bd6c16a53c87100dfbeaac6685b8fef73862a33 OP_EQUAL
address
3BXDVYakVuf692R2w3CK9C8we3VTsXwLKi
transaction
c4fd590d72412353bc023e5caabcb924be7aeb66c59849daaa01672605681879